About Hungarian Antique Linen Grain and flour Sacks

Vintage grain sacks come in a variety of weaves and stripe colours.  The stripe indictaed to the mill the owner of the sack, ensuring that the milled grain when back to the correct owner. Some of these sack also have beautiful hand embrodiered monograms. It seems incredible to us now that such work went into creating  such an item.

These sacks have been  hand woven, mostly from home spun vintage linen hemp. Hemp  softens and lightens with age and washing. These sacks date from the early 1900s to about 1940.  The cloth is fantastic and  the sacks are full of character. 

This fabric was painstakingly home loomed and has a lovely home woven quality.
